| Objective: In this study,the method of CT texture analysis was used to extract the characteristic information from the CT-enhanced image of the neck of the primary tumor lesions,to predicting the feasibility cervical lymph node metastasis in patients with hypopharyngeal carcinoma before operation.Provide new ideas and new methods for preoperative examination and diagnosis of patients with hypopharyngeal cancer.Methods:1The clinical information of 42 patients with hypopharyngeal cancer diagnosed and treated in Subei People’s Hospital between 2015.01-2020.10 were selected and collected.Screening enrolled patients: All patients in the group underwent surgical treatment within 1 month after CT examination.No radiotherapy or chemotherapy was performed before the CT examination.All patients underwent cervical lymph node dissection.According to the accurate pathological p TMN staging provided by the post-operative pathology,and no lymph node metastasis or primary tumor recurrence occurred in the follow-up 6 months after surgery,a total of 33 patients were enrolled in the study.The postoperative pathological examination results of the two groups of patients were used as the basis for grouping,including pN0 13 cases,pN112 cases,and pN2 8 cases.They were further divided into the non-lymph node metastasis group,namely pN0(n=13)and the lymph node metastasis group,namely pN+(n=20).2.Acquire CT enhanced images of neck,and collect two images of the patient’s arterial phase and venous phase showing the largest level of the lesion.All images are segmented by professional rendering software.Use Ma Zda4.6 software to manually delineate the Region of interest(ROI)on the patient’s neck CT enhanced image.Use software to extract texture parameters,and extract 5 texture parameters with reference value: Mean value,Skewness,Correlation,Entropy and Kurtosis.Compare the difference of the texture parameter values on the venous phase and arterial phase of the cervical CT enhancement between the two groups of patients,and perform statistical analysis on the values of the extracted texture parameters.Draw statistically different texture parameter values through receiver operator characteristic(,ROC).Calculate area underthe ROC curve(AUC),judge diagnostic efficiency analysis,calculate Sensitivity and Specificity.Result:1.Difference test: In the pN0 group and pN+ group,P=0.567 for the age of patients,and P=0.614 for the T stage.Therefore,both age and T stage are not statistically significant in the statistics of the two groups(P> 0.05).The p-values of the Mean value,Skewness,and Kurtosis of the vein phase texture analysis values of the pN0 group and pN+ group were 0.652,0.205,and 0.611,and the p-values of the Mean value,Skewness,and Kurtosis of the arterial phase were 0.985,0.5000,0.321,all greater than 0.05,so it is considered that there is no statistical difference in the Mean value,Skewness and Kurtosis between the pN0 group and the pN+ group.The P-value of the venous phase correlation between the pN0 group and the pN+ group is 0.004 and less than 0.005;the P value of the arterial phase correlation between the pN0 group and the pN+ group is0.004 and less than 0.005,the Correlation between the two groups is statistically different.The P-values of the entropy values of the arterial phase and the venous phase between the pN0 group and the pN+ group were less than 0.001,There are significant statistical differences in Entropy between the two groups.Select the texture analysis value with statistical difference to draw ROC curve and judge its diagnostic energy efficiency.2.In the venous phase,Entropy AUC=0.858 Correlation AUC=0.804,the value of AUC is between 0.7-0.9,In the arterial phase,the Entropy AUC=0.877 Correlation AUC=0.785,and the value of AUC is between 0.7-0.9.Therefore,the value of Entropy and the value of Correlation have certain accuracy in judging cervical lymph node metastasis of hypopharyngeal cancer.Conclusion:The Entropy value and Correlation value in the texture parameter can be used to distinguish tumor heterogeneity and other characteristics to predict and judge the neck lymph node metastasis.The Entropy of texture parameters in the venous phase and the Entropy of texture parameters in the arterial phase can be used as independent predictors its sensitivity and specificity have good performance.The texture analysis method can provide new methods and ideas for judging the status of lymph node metastasis before clinical operation. |
